Output 6986d37ff03254dfb4d38d4a39fc2f133db165ae823819d3e15f8f745cc071d0:20

value
591772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2a7e2172f46ac56ee16eaab8d7a2ab7707c0a43 OP_EQUAL
address
3LtrwZ9NpcpAELgkqU87JnhJ2kiMW9SxKm
transaction
6986d37ff03254dfb4d38d4a39fc2f133db165ae823819d3e15f8f745cc071d0
spent
true